OpenAI is shuttering popular video-creation app Sora the company said in a statement Tuesday.

The company announced on X ... "We’re saying goodbye to Sora. To everyone who created with Sora, shared it, and built community around it: thank you. What you made with Sora mattered, and we know this news is disappointing."

The platform utilized generative A.I. to turn user-provided text prompts into realistic-looking videos ... of pretty much anything.

Last year, Sora was the focal point of a "South Park" episode -- where the characters were using the app to make a bunch of deepfake revenge videos of each other.

And in December, OpenAI made a 3-year deal with Disney ... allowing Sora users to create videos from more than 200 characters across their IP -- including Marvel, Star Wars, Pixar, and, of course, Disney. Disney+ was even adding some of these videos to its streaming service.

In the wake of the news, the media conglomerate pulled the plug on the OpenAI agreement. A Disney rep told Variety in a statement they "respect" the move to axe Sora and "appreciate the constructive collaboration."

Disney said ... "We will continue to engage with A.I. platforms to find new ways to meet fans where they are while responsibly embracing new technologies that respect IP and the rights of creators."

The Sora team said they'll be updating users soon about timelines and logistics, as well as "preserving your work."

A professional cornhole player who happens to be a quadruple amputee is facing murder charges over the shooting death of a man in Maryland ... TMZ Sports has learned.

According to the Charles County Sheriff’s Office, Dayton James Webber was booked Sunday after witnesses said he shot and killed a passenger in his car earlier the same day.

The sheriff's office says the witnesses were in the back seat when Webber -- who they say was driving -- got into an argument with the front seat passenger. Witnesses told police that’s when the 27-year-old pulled a gun and fatally shot the passenger. Cops say they all knew each other.

According to law enforcement, the witnesses said Webber pulled the car over and asked them to help pull the body out of the car ... but they told authorities they said no, and got out of the car … while Webber drove off with the alleged victim's body still in the car.

Later, cops say they got a call about a body in a yard … and identified the man as Bradrick Michael Wells, also 27, who was pronounced dead at the scene.

Officers say they found Webber’s car in Charlottesville, Virginia before tracking him down at a nearby hospital … where they say he was trying to get treated for “a medical issue.”

He was booked in Virginia by the Albemarle County Police Department and subsequently charged as a fugitive from justice. According to officers, he’s set to be extradited back to Maryland, where authorities say he will be charged with first-degree and second-degree murder, and other charges.

A collision between a plane and a fire truck on the runway at New York's LaGuardia Airport overnight killed two pilots and injured dozens of people, according to authorities.

Officials say the Air Canada Express regional jet collided with a Port Authority fire truck while landing in Queens early Monday after departing from Montreal, Canada on Sunday night.

ATC.com audio captured the moments leading up to the tragedy, with the fire truck initially receiving permission to cross the runway. But then an air traffic controller abruptly says, “Stop, Truck 1, stop!” Seconds later, a controller adds, “Jazz 646, I see you collided with a vehicle.”

An unsettling situation went down this morning at Newark Liberty International Airport … with air traffic controllers evacuated from the tower after reports of smoke, triggering a ground stop.

The FAA said the tower was evacuated due to a burning smell coming from an elevator ... and said there was no fire. As a result, arrivals and departures are temporarily paused.

The incident is especially unnerving given what went down at LaGuardia Airport just hours earlier ... when a collision between an Air Canada jet and a fire truck on the runway killed two pilots and injured dozens of people.
